MySQL 教程 PDF 文章 引言MySQL一款廣泛使用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ng)(RDBMS),由瑞典 MySQL AB 公司開發(fā),目前屬于 Oracle 公司。它以其高性能、可靠性、靈活性和可擴展性而聞名,被廣泛應(yīng)用于各種規(guī)模的應(yīng)用程序中。本教程旨在為初學(xué)者和中級用戶提供一個全面的 MySQL 學(xué)習(xí)指南,幫助您從入門到精通 MySQL 數(shù)據(jù)庫管理。
MySQL 教程 PDF 文章 MySQL一款廣泛使用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ng)(RDBMS),由瑞典 MySQL AB 公司開發(fā),目前屬于 Oracle 公司。它以其高性能、可靠性、靈活性和可擴展性而聞名,被廣泛應(yīng)用于各種規(guī)模的應(yīng)用程序中。本教程旨在為初學(xué)者和中級用戶提供一個全面的 MySQL 學(xué)習(xí)指南,幫助您從入門到精通 MySQL 數(shù)據(jù)庫管理。 MySQL一個開源的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它使用結(jié)構(gòu)化查詢語言(SQL)來管理和操作數(shù)據(jù)。以下是 MySQL 的一些關(guān)鍵特點: 高性能:支持高并發(fā)的讀寫操作。 可靠性:提供 ACID 事務(wù)支持,確保數(shù)據(jù)的一致性和完整性。 靈活性:支持多種數(shù)據(jù)類型和復(fù)雜的查詢。 可擴展性:適用于小型應(yīng)用到大型企業(yè)級應(yīng)用。 在開始使用 MySQL 之前,您需要先安裝和配置它。以下是安裝 MySQL 的基本步驟: 訪問 MySQL 官方網(wǎng)站下載適合 Widows 的安裝程序。 運行安裝程序,并根據(jù)向?qū)崾就瓿砂惭b。 在安裝過程中,設(shè)置 roo 用戶的密碼。 打開終端,執(zhí)行以下命令更新軟件包列表: sudo ap updae 使用以下命令安裝 MySQL: sudo ap isall mysql-server 安裝完成后,通過以下命令增強安全性: sudo mysqlsecureisallaio 確保已安裝 Homebrew。 在終端輸入以下命令安裝 MySQL: brew isall mysql 安裝后,初始化數(shù)據(jù)庫并增強安全性: mysqlsecureisallaio 了解 MySQL 的基本概念對于學(xué)習(xí)和使用 MySQL 至關(guān)重要。以下是幾個關(guān)鍵概念: 數(shù)據(jù)庫是用于存儲數(shù)據(jù)的容器,可以包含多個數(shù)據(jù)表。數(shù)據(jù)表是數(shù)據(jù)庫中的基本存儲單元,用于存儲數(shù)據(jù)。 數(shù)據(jù)表由字段組成,每個字段都有其特定的數(shù)據(jù)類型,如整數(shù)、字符串、日期等。 索引是數(shù)據(jù)庫中用于加速查詢的數(shù)據(jù)結(jié)構(gòu)。通過創(chuàng)建索引,可以加快對數(shù)據(jù)表的查詢速度。 SQL用于操作數(shù)據(jù)庫的語言。以下是幾個基本的 SQL 語句: 使用以下語句創(chuàng)建一個新的數(shù)據(jù)庫: 使用以下語句選擇要操作的數(shù)據(jù)庫: 使用以下語句創(chuàng)建一個新的數(shù)據(jù)表: MySQL 提供了許多高級特性,包括: 了解如何創(chuàng)建和使用索引來加速查詢,包括 B-Tree 索引、全文索引和空間索引等。 掌握子查詢、聯(lián)合查詢和窗口函數(shù)等高級查詢技術(shù),以進行更復(fù)雜的分析。 創(chuàng)建存儲過程以封裝一組 SQL 語句,提高代碼復(fù)用性和維護性引言
MySQL 簡介
MySQL 安裝與配置
Widows 安裝
Liux 安裝(以 Ubuu 為例)
MacOS 安裝
MySQL 基本概念
數(shù)據(jù)庫與數(shù)據(jù)表
字段與數(shù)據(jù)類型
索引
基本 SQL 語句
創(chuàng)建數(shù)據(jù)庫
CREATE DATABASE daabaseame;
選擇數(shù)據(jù)庫
USE daabaseame;
創(chuàng)建表
CREATE TABLE ableame ( colum1 daaype, colum2 daaype, ...);
高級特性
索引優(yōu)化
高級查詢技術(shù)
存儲過程與函數(shù)